1/* 2 * Copyright (C) 2010 The Android Open Source Project 3 * 4 * Licensed under the Apache License, Version 2.0 (the "License"); 5 * you may not use this file except in compliance with the License. 6 * You may obtain a copy of the License at 7 * 8 * http://www.apache.org/licenses/LICENSE-2.0 9 * 10 * Unless required by applicable law or agreed to in writing, software 11 * distributed under the License is distributed on an "AS IS" BASIS, 12 *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. 13 * See the License for the specific language governing permissions and 14 * limitations under the License. 15 */ 16 17#ifndef ANDROID_GUI_ISURFACETEXTURE_H 18#define ANDROID_GUI_ISURFACETEXTURE_H 19 20#include <stdint.h> 21#include <sys/types.h> 22 23#include <utils/Errors.h> 24#include <utils/RefBase.h> 25 26#include <binder/IInterface.h> 27 28#include <ui/GraphicBuffer.h> 29#include <ui/Rect.h> 30 31namespace android { 32// ---------------------------------------------------------------------------- 33 34class SurfaceTextureClient; 35 36class ISurfaceTexture : public IInterface 37{ 38public: 39 DECLARE_META_INTERFACE(SurfaceTexture); 40 41protected: 42 friend class SurfaceTextureClient; 43 44 enum { BUFFER_NEEDS_REALLOCATION = 1 }; 45 46 // requestBuffer requests a new buffer for the given index. The server (i.e. 47 // the ISurfaceTexture implementation) assigns the newly created buffer to 48 // the given slot index, and the client is expected to mirror the 49 // slot->buffer mapping so that it's not necessary to transfer a 50 // GraphicBuffer for every dequeue operation. 51 virtual sp<GraphicBuffer> requestBuffer(int slot) = 0; 52 53 // setBufferCount sets the number of buffer slots available. Calling this 54 // will also cause all buffer slots to be emptied. The caller should empty 55 // its mirrored copy of the buffer slots when calling this method. 56 virtual status_t setBufferCount(int bufferCount) = 0; 57 58 // dequeueBuffer requests a new buffer slot for the client to use. Ownership 59 // of the slot is transfered to the client, meaning that the server will not 60 // use the contents of the buffer associated with that slot. The slot index 61 // returned may or may not contain a buffer. If the slot is empty the client 62 // should call requestBuffer to assign a new buffer to that slot. The client 63 // is expected to either call cancelBuffer on the dequeued slot or to fill 64 // in the contents of its associated buffer contents and call queueBuffer. 65 // If dequeueBuffer return BUFFER_NEEDS_REALLOCATION, the client is 66 // expected to call requestBuffer immediately. 67 virtual status_t dequeueBuffer(int *slot, uint32_t w, uint32_t h, 68 uint32_t format, uint32_t usage) = 0; 69 70 // queueBuffer indicates that the client has finished filling in the 71 // contents of the buffer associated with slot and transfers ownership of 72 // that slot back to the server. It is not valid to call queueBuffer on a 73 // slot that is not owned by the client or one for which a buffer associated 74 // via requestBuffer. In addition, a timestamp must be provided by the 75 // client for this buffer. The timestamp is measured in nanoseconds, and 76 // must be monotonically increasing. Its other properties (zero point, etc) 77 // are client-dependent, and should be documented by the client. 78 virtual status_t queueBuffer(int slot, int64_t timestamp) = 0; 79 80 // cancelBuffer indicates that the client does not wish to fill in the 81 // buffer associated with slot and transfers ownership of the slot back to 82 // the server. 83 virtual void cancelBuffer(int slot) = 0; 84 85 virtual status_t setCrop(const Rect& reg) = 0; 86 virtual status_t setTransform(uint32_t transform) = 0; 87 88 // getAllocator retrieves the binder object that must be referenced as long 89 // as the GraphicBuffers dequeued from this ISurfaceTexture are referenced. 90 // Holding this binder reference prevents SurfaceFlinger from freeing the 91 // buffers before the client is done with them. 92 virtual sp<IBinder> getAllocator() = 0; 93 94 // query retrieves some information for this surface 95 // 'what' tokens allowed are that of android_natives.h 96 virtual int query(int what, int* value) = 0; 97}; 98 99// ---------------------------------------------------------------------------- 100 101class BnSurfaceTexture : public BnInterface<ISurfaceTexture> 102{ 103public: 104 virtual status_t onTransact( uint32_t code, 105 const Parcel& data, 106 Parcel* reply, 107 uint32_t flags = 0); 108}; 109 110// ---------------------------------------------------------------------------- 111}; // namespace android 112 113#endif // ANDROID_GUI_ISURFACETEXTURE_H 114
